A Decade of Digital Transformation

Over the past ten years, the Philippines has transitioned from having a peripheral IT industry to becoming a tech-enabled nation. Information Technology (IT) is now a central pillar of the economy, reshaping education, healthcare, business, and governance. More significantly, it’s helping to build a more inclusive digital society, connecting even the most remote communities to opportunities.

The foundation of this transformation lies in digital infrastructure. Early investments in broadband and submarine cables laid the groundwork. Today, fiber-optic networks and 5G connectivity span cities and towns, while public-private partnerships are bringing internet access to far-flung barangays. Initiatives like the National Broadband Plan and Digital Cities 2025 signal the government’s serious commitment to digital empowerment.

People Power: The Heart of Tech Growth

The Philippines' greatest tech asset is its people. With a median age of 25 and a large pool of English-speaking, tech-literate graduates, the country is a hotspot for global outsourcing. Foreign companies are increasingly setting up shop in hubs like Manila, Cebu, and Davao, drawn by cost advantages and cultural compatibility.

But the future is not just about call centers. The local IT workforce is evolving toward software development, cybersecurity, and artificial intelligence. Filipino startups are stepping up, raising capital, and building products that compete on the world stage.

E-Commerce & FinTech: The Digital Economy Boom

The pandemic accelerated digital adoption. Today, mobile payments and online shopping are second nature. Platforms like Lazada, Shopee, GCash, and Maya have transformed how Filipinos shop and manage money. At the same time, digital tools are empowering small entrepreneurs, from home-based sellers to sari-sari stores.

Even agriculture is going digital. Farmers now use tech platforms to access price information, manage logistics, and reach markets—showing that IT is touching even the most traditional sectors.

Education and Healthcare Go Digital

Education in the Philippines has seen one of the most dramatic shifts. The pandemic pushed schools online, and now, Learning Management Systems and hybrid learning are here to stay. Government and private sector efforts are ensuring digital literacy reaches rural areas, helping to create a future-ready workforce.

In healthcare, innovations like telemedicine, electronic medical records, and AI-assisted diagnostics are becoming standard. Government services are also embracing digital—from PhilSys (the national ID system) to online portals for taxes and licenses, digital efficiency is now the goal.

Innovation from the Ground Up

The Philippine startup ecosystem is gaining ground. Support from the DTI Startup Grant Fund and QBO Innovation Hub is enabling local innovators to build tech that addresses real-world problems. Companies like Sprout Solutions, Edukasyon.ph, and Great Deals E-commerce show the world that Filipino innovation is global in outlook and impact.

A Glimpse into the Digital Future

Looking ahead, trends like blockchain, IoT, AI, and green IT are poised to shape the Philippines’ tech landscape. ESG (Environmental, Social, Governance) practices are being adopted, while ASEAN integration opens doors to regional collaboration and market expansion.

Challenges remain—cybersecurity, data privacy, and the digital divide must be addressed. But with strong public-private cooperation and ethical tech development, the Philippines is on track for a secure, inclusive digital future.
